Expert Guide to Achieving a Spotless Bathroom Floor Every Time


Materials:
- Broom: 1 unit
- Vacuum cleaner: 1 unit
- Microfiber mop: 1 unit
- Bucket: 1 unit
- Rubber gloves: 1 pair
- White vinegar: 1 cup
- Baking soda: 1/2 cup
- Mild detergent: 1 bottle
- Scrub brush: 1 unit
DIY Steps:
- Preparation: Clear the bathroom floor of any mats, rugs, or objects. Sweep the floor to remove loose dirt and debris.
- Vacuum: Use a vacuum cleaner to ensure thorough removal of dust and hair.
- Mix Cleaning Solution: In a bucket, combine 1 cup of white vinegar with 1 gallon of warm water. Add 1/2 cup of baking soda for extra cleaning power.
- Cleaning Process: Dip a microfiber mop into the solution and wring it out. Mop the floor in sections, starting from the farthest corner and working towards the door.
- Scrubbing: For stubborn stains, apply a mixture of mild detergent and water to the area. Use a scrub brush to gently scrub the stained area.
- Rinse: Rinse the mop frequently in clean water to prevent spreading dirt. Change the cleaning solution if it becomes dirty.

- Troubleshooting Tips: If the floor remains sticky after cleaning, rinse with plain water. For lingering odors, try a vinegar solution rinse.
